a.nav_off:link { color:#ffffff; text-decoration:none; font-size:16px;}
a.nav_off:hover { color:#ffffff;  text-decoration:none; font-size:16px;}
a.nav_off:visited { color:#ffffff;  text-decoration:none; font-size:16px;}
a.nav_off:active { color:#ffffff;  text-decoration:none;  font-size:16px;} 

a.nav_on:link { color:#E2E8F2; text-decoration:none; font-size:16px; background-color:#3f72b4; padding: 16px 18px 17px 18px; margin-top:-15px; border-right: 0;}
a.nav_on:hover { color:#E2E8F2;  text-decoration:none; font-size:16px; background-color:#3f72b4; padding: 17px 18px; margin-top:-15px; border-right: 0;}
a.nav_on:visited { color:#E2E8F2;  text-decoration:none;  font-size:16px; background-color:#3f72b4; padding: 17px 18px; margin-top:-15px; border-right: 0;}
a.nav_on:active { color:#E2E8F2;  text-decoration:none; font-size:16px; background-color:#3f72b4; padding: 17px 18px; margin-top:-15px; border-right: 0;}

li.navsimple {
    /*height:27px; */
    padding:0 10px 0 10px; 

}



#nav {
	width:960px;
	height:15px;
	margin:0 auto;
	text-align:left;
	z-index:5;
}

#nav ul { /* all lists */
	padding: 0 10px;
	margin: 0;
	list-style: none;
	line-height: 1;
	z-index:5;
	-moz-box-shadow: 0px 0px 6px #000;
	-webkit-box-shadow: 0px 0px 6px #000;
	box-shadow: 0px 0px 6px #000;


    /* both of these were giving dropshadows to the text in navbar on ie8/rdp */
    
	/* For IE 8 */
	/*-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=4, Direction=135, Color='#000000')";*/
	
    /* For IE 5.5 - 7 */

	/*filter: progid:DXImageTransform.Microsoft.Shadow(Strength=4, Direction=135, Color='#000000');*/
}

/* LINK STYLES FOR MAIN LEVEL NAV BUTTONS */

#nav ul a, #nav ul a:hover {
	display: block;
}

#nav ul a:hover {
}

#nav li:hover {
   /*background-color:#AC2E41;*/
}

#nav ul li {
	display: block;
	color: white;
	font-size: 15px;
	font-family: Helvetica;
	margin: 0 auto;
	font-weight: bolder;
	text-transform: uppercase;
	border-right: 1px #384073 solid;
	float: left;
}

#nav li.last {
	border: 0;
}

#nav ul li ul a, #nav ul li ul a:hover {
	display: block;
	padding:.5em 1em;
	font-family:Arial, Helvetica, sans-serif;
	font-size:16px;
	font-weight:normal;
	color:#ffffff;
	text-decoration:none;
	text-transform: capitalize;
	/*border-bottom:1px solid #40284f;*/
	voice-family: "\"}\""; 
	voice-family:inherit;
	width: 13.5em;
	z-index:-1;
}

#nav li ul { /* second-level lists */
	/*padding-top: 60px;*/
	padding-right: 5px;
	padding-left: 5px;
	position: absolute;
	/*background: #ac2e41;*/
    background:#23273F;
	width: 16.75em;
	left: -999em; /* using left instead of display to hide menus because display: none isn't read by screen readers */
	margin-top:-40px;
    margin-left: -20px;
}

#nav ul li ul li {
	border: 0;
}

#nav li.head {
	border: 0;
}
#nav ul li ul a:hover {
	color:#ffffff;
	text-decoration:none;
	background:#3F72B4;
	/*border-bottom:1px solid #40284f;*/
}

#nav li:hover ul ul, #nav li:hover ul ul ul, #nav li.sfhover ul ul, #nav li.sfhover ul ul ul {
	left: -999em;
}

#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ul { /* lists nested under hovered list items */
	left: auto;
	background-position: 0 0;
}

/* check me  (selected tab hover state correction)*/ 
#nav li.navsimple_on ul {
    margin-left: 0px;
    margin-top: -58px;
}

.nav_last_item {
    padding-bottom:10px;
}

.sectionHead a {
    text-transform: uppercase !important;
    padding: 25px 15px 15px !important;
    font-weight: bold !important;
}

.sectionHead a:hover {
    background-color: #23273F !important;
}

li.highlighted  a {
  background-color: #3F72B4;
}